Output 626dacbacd024312ac72f5e9c89d79af9e03dcf45a187ff955e01de5808af5b4:1

value
24822435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58248be018e04d7e7f5d3a3d7bff629ca169f954 OP_EQUAL
address
MFwDUbgjLKSdrRtQaEcSYWDTg7C1hw7Y8t
transaction
626dacbacd024312ac72f5e9c89d79af9e03dcf45a187ff955e01de5808af5b4
spent
true